Core Skills Analysis
Physical Development
- Improved gross motor skills through climbing and sliding.
- Enhanced coordination and balance while running and jumping.
- Engaged in physical play that promotes healthy body development.
- Learned to take turns on playground equipment, fostering social skills.
Social Skills
- Practiced sharing toys and equipment with peers.
- Developed communication skills by interacting with other children.
- Learned conflict resolution through negotiation during play.
- Formed friendships by collaborating in group games.
Cognitive Development
- Engaged in problem-solving when figuring out how to navigate the playground.
- Enhanced spatial awareness through movement around large structures.
- Discovered cause and effect by observing the results of their actions (e.g., sliding down fast or slow).
- Used imagination in pretend play with peers, fostering creativity.
Emotional Development
- Recognized and expressed emotions through play (e.g., excitement, frustration).
- Developed self-regulation by waiting for turns on equipment.
- Gained confidence by mastering climbing and sliding skills.
- Learned empathy by understanding other children's feelings during play.
Tips
To further enhance exploration and improvement, consider incorporating more structured play activities that emphasize teamwork and collaboration. Encourage the child to engage in imaginative role-playing scenarios with peers to build creative thinking and emotional understanding. Activities such as group games can also develop social skills and teamwork, while outdoor scavenger hunts can promote cognitive skills like observation and critical thinking.
